Here's something completely different. A nuts & bolts question, as it were. This AM, I was in conversation with a friend and she was called away to answer the door. She said she'd call back and I went back to the threads. Couple hours pass and I wonder why no call. Turns out that my Qwest land line did not ring when she called back almost immediately. I didn't have any music running, so I should have heard the ringer, then I should have heard the TAD announce my message and hear her being recorded. None of this happened. I simply happened to glance at the TAD and see she'd called and left a brief message. This is the second time in a week I've experienced this aberrant behaviour. She indicated that when she called, everything seemed normal from her end, i.e. the phone "rang" 4 times and then the TAD responded. The first time this occurred last week, I called myself from another line and everything was fine. Same this time. Any idea what might be going on here? I assume there is something in Qwest's software that is run amok, and not a TAD issues, since it appeared to my caller that the ringer was normal.
